Coercion from and to zoo
Methods for coercing "zoo"
objects to other classes and
a generic function as.zoo
for coercing objects to class "zoo"
.

Usage
as.zoo(x, ...)
Arguments
- x
- an object,
- ...
- further arguments passed to
zoo
when the return object is created.
Details
as.zoo
currently has a default method and methods
for ts
, its
and irts
objects
(and zoo
objects themselves).
Methods for coercing objects of class "zoo"
to other classes
currently include: as.ts
, as.matrix
, as.vector
,
as.data.frame
, as.list
(the latter also being available
for "ts"
objects). Furthermore the coercion function
as.its.zoo
is provided, but works only
if the corresponding package is attached.
In the conversion between zoo
and ts
, the zooreg
class is
always used.
Value
as.zoo
returns azoo
object.
See Also
Examples
## coercion to zoo:
## default method
as.zoo(rnorm(5))
## method for "ts" objects
as.zoo(ts(rnorm(5), start = 1981, freq = 12))
## coercion from zoo:
x.date <- as.POSIXct(paste("2003-", rep(1:4, 4:1), "-", sample(1:28, 10, replace = TRUE), sep = ""))
x <- zoo(matrix(rnorm(24), ncol = 2), x.date)
as.matrix(x)
as.vector(x)
as.data.frame(x)
as.list(x)
